The Bandra police arrested two people — a man and a woman — in two separate incidents for allegedly attempting to enter Bollywood actor Salman Khan’s house in Galaxy Apartments in Bandra West. The police have registered two different FIRs, one on Tuesday and another on Wednesday, and have begun investigations into the matter.
Police have identified the two people as a 22-year-old woman, Nisha Chabra, a junior artiste who wanted to meet the actor, and a 22-year-old fan of Khan, Jitendra Kumar Hardayal Singh. “In the first incident, Singh was seen loitering near Galaxy Apartments on Tuesday around 9.45 am. He told the security guard that he wanted to meet Salman Khan, but the guard refused and advised him to leave the premises. Singh became angry and threw his mobile phone at the ground before leaving the area,” said a police officer.
However, later that evening, Singh returned at around 7.15 pm and managed to sneak into the society, hiding behind a car. A police officer and security guard Kamlesh Mishra caught him and handed him over to the Bandra police for further investigation. The Bandra police promptly registered an FIR against Singh and arrested him. Singh, a resident of Chhattisgarh, told the police that he is a fan of Khan and wanted to meet the actor for a selfie, but the security guard did not allow him. This prompted him to enter the apartment unlawfully.
In another incident which took place on Wednesday, Chabra was caught by the security guard and police while trying to enter the Galaxy Apartments. The woman, a junior artiste, told the police that she wanted to meet Salman Khan in the hope of getting film roles. She also revealed that she has been struggling to find work in the film industry for some time, and that the actor had given her appointment so she tried to meet him. Khan, who has received several threats from the Lawrence Bishnoi gang, has been provided ‘Y-plus' security cover by the Mumbai police.
